In 1986, China's first wind farm – Malan wind farm in Rongcheng, Shandong Province, is a milestone in the history of China's wind power, from which China's wind power is really in its development stage. However, in the early demonstration stage, the scale of China's wind power is very small.

In 2023, the Asian country added some 76.7 gigawatts of wind power, which translates to more than three-quarters of the global capacity added that year. Overall, China accounted for almost half of cumulative wind power installations worldwide as of end of 2023. Find up-to-date statistics and facts on the global wind power market.
Among China's local wind turbine manufacturers, seven large wind turbine manufacturers—Goldwind, United Power, Mingyang, Huarui, Envision, Dongfang Electric and ShangHai Electric—account for 68% of the domestic market . Goldwind ranks first, with 23.65% of the domestic cumulative WP market. Fig. 11.
